A heavy, block-built display face with squarish silhouettes, rounded corners, and subtly irregular edges that feel slightly “hand-pressed” rather than mechanically perfect. Counters are generally small and simplified, often appearing as squared cut-ins or slits, which creates a dense, poster-like texture in text. Strokes stay monolinear and blunt-ended, with occasional wedge-like notches and asymmetries that add bounce and personality. Overall spacing and rhythm are compact and punchy, favoring solid shapes over fine detail.
Best suited to short display settings such as posters, headlines, branding marks, packaging, and album or event graphics where strong silhouette recognition matters. It can add character to titles, badges, and playful UI moments, especially when set large. For longer passages, more spacing and larger sizes help preserve clarity.
The font reads as playful and offbeat, with a cartoonish, toy-block energy and a mild retro arcade/handmade vibe. Its quirky cuts and softened corners keep it friendly rather than aggressive, making it feel humorous and attention-seeking. The overall tone is bold, casual, and intentionally imperfect.
This design appears intended to deliver maximum visual impact through chunky geometry and deliberately irregular detailing, prioritizing character and silhouette over neutrality. The simplified counters and softened corners suggest a playful, approachable display voice meant to stand out quickly in graphic applications.
In continuous text, the dense letterforms and small counters create a strong black mass, so the design performs best when given generous size and breathing room. The distinctive notches and squared apertures give it a recognizable “stamped” character that stands out in headlines.
